Why does my floor or wall still feel damp after I've wiped up the water?

'Dry to the touch' is not a structural drying standard. Heppner's ambient air typically holds about 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) of moisture at 70°F. Wet materials create a vapor pressure differential, forcing moisture into the air and surrounding structures. Our psychrometric drying process lowers the GPP in the air to draw out this trapped moisture, meeting the IICRC S500 standard for equilibrium.

My insurance says it's 'Category 2' water. What does that mean, and can smart home devices help?

Category 2 water contains significant contamination, like dishwasher or washing machine discharge. It is not 'clean.' 'Category 3' is grossly contaminated black water from sewage or flooding. Installing IoT leak sensors (like Moen Flo) can provide immediate alerts, limit damage, and qualifies for a 5% premium credit discount with most Oregon insurers by demonstrating proactive risk management.

How long do I have before mold becomes a serious concern?

The microbial growth window is 48–72 hours from the initial water intrusion. After this period, surface cleaning is insufficient and professional remediation under containment is the Standard of Care. Starting mitigation within this window is critical; delaying beyond it can shift liability and complicate your insurance claim under 2026 policy language.
